Q

What is vertical SaaS and how does it work?

Vertical SaaS refers to specialized software-as-a-service products designed to meet the specific needs of a particular industry or niche, such as health and fitness, rather than serving broad, cross-industry functions. These platforms offer deep industry-specific features, workflows, and compliance tools that generic software cannot provide. For example, a vertical SaaS for fitness studios would manage class bookings, member wellness metrics, and specialized equipment inventory, unlike a horizontal CRM. The primary benefit is a higher degree of out-of-the-box functionality, reducing customization needs and accelerating time-to-value for businesses within that vertical. Implementation typically involves cloud-based subscription access, with the vendor responsible for updates, security, and industry-specific regulatory adherence.

Q

What are the main advantages of using a vertical SaaS platform?

The main advantages of using a vertical SaaS platform are deep industry specialization, reduced implementation complexity, and built-in regulatory compliance. Unlike horizontal software, a vertical SaaS solution comes pre-configured with terminology, workflows, and reporting specific to a niche, such as patient management for telehealth or membership lifecycle tools for fitness clubs. This drastically reduces the time and cost of customization and staff training. Secondly, these platforms often include compliance features for industry standards like HIPAA in healthcare or data privacy regulations, which are integrated by default. Finally, vertical SaaS providers typically offer superior industry-specific support and foster user communities where best practices are shared, leading to more effective software utilization and continuous improvement aligned with sector trends.

Q

How to choose the right vertical SaaS solution for a business?

To choose the right vertical SaaS solution, a business must first conduct a thorough audit of its niche-specific operational workflows and compliance requirements. Start by identifying the core processes that are unique to your industry, such as appointment scheduling for a clinic or equipment maintenance logging for a gym, and ensure the software has dedicated modules for these. Next, verify the platform's adherence to relevant industry regulations and data security standards, which are non-negotiable. Evaluate the vendor's track record within your vertical, including customer case studies and the responsiveness of their industry-trained support team. Finally, assess the scalability of the solution to ensure it can grow with your business and integrate with existing tools, avoiding future costly migrations or workarounds.

    LLM-crawlable llms.txt
    Create an llms.txt file to guide AI crawlers to your most important, high-quality pages (docs, pricing, about, key guides). Keep it short, well-structured, and focused on authoritative URLs you want cited. Treat it as a curated “AI sitemap” that improves discovery and reduces the risk of crawlers prioritizing low-value pages.
